A new study shows that teenagers who consumed marijuana before 15 were more likely to seek physical or mental medical care than their counterparts. Doctors are still piecing together the short and long term effects of thc, especially when it comes to kids and teens. but early research is giving experts plenty to worry about. The more america knows about the real harms of this drug and just how much damage the marijuana industry does, the stronger the backlash to legalization, commercialization, and normalization will grow. And the latest nsduh is flashing a huge warning signal about kids, weed, and the addiction industry. from 2014 to 2024, cannabis use disorder (cud) among kids aged 12 17 increased from 2.7% to 4.7%, a 74% increase. in raw numbers, that’s an increase from 667,000 kids to 1.2 million kids with cud.
